U.S. Army Corps of Engineers Lead Program Analyst in Kuwait, Kuwait

Summary About the Position: Must be able to satisfy the requirements of the 26JUL12 DODI 1400.25 V1230, DoD Civilian Personnel Management System: Employment in Foreign Areas and Employee Return Rights. This announcement is for Temporary deployment tours which vary in length depending on location. Tour lengths may be 6 months, 9 months or 1 year being the most often used. Responsibilities Provides technical expertise to manage the fiscal functions essential to the mission execution of an overseas District Office. Responsible for up to 400 projects funded by numerous appropriations and managed through a wide variety of reporting and information systems. Provides guidance and advice to the technical staff regarding statutory, and regulatory funding limitations. Develops independent statistical studies and analysis incident to mission performance and internal programming review and analysis. Analyzes actual costs against construction contract placement to assure supervision and administration (S and A) goals are not exceeded. Advises program and project managers in relating program objectives to available funds. Distributes and balance workload and tasks among employees in accordance with established work flow, makes adjustments to accomplish the workload in accordance with established priorities. Maintains current financial and technical knowledge to answer questions from team members on program or financial procedures and policies. To qualify based on your experience, your resume must describe at least one year of experience which prepared you to do the work in this job. Specialized experience is defined as: providing technical expertise to manage the fiscal functions essential to the mission of an overseas office; analyzing existing design and construction projects for future design and construction forecasts; advising program and project managers in relating program objectives to available funds. This definition of specialized experience is typical of work performed at the next lower grade/level position in the federal service (GS-12). You will be evaluated on the basis of your level of competency in the following areas: Administration and Management Cost Estimation and Analysis Workforce Planning Time in Grade Requirement: Applicants who have held a General Schedule (GS) position within the last 52 weeks must have 52 weeks of Federal service at the next lower grade or equivalent (GS-12). All qualification requirements must be met within 30 days of the closing date of this announcement. Education Some federal jobs allow you to substitute your education for the required experience in order to qualify. For this job, you must meet the qualification requirement using experience alone--no substitution of education for experience is permitted.
